  • This colt was born to Ruby Too on Easter Sunday. I checked them after church and found Ruby had a retained placenta. We took care of that and all was well. Three months later, Ruby was found dead in the pasture. Her two pasture mates adopted and raised this colt.

    Mendota Ranch is a working ranch in Canadian Texas. Established in 1907 and owned by the Abraham family since 1994, Mendota Ranch operates a commercial cow / calf operation, and raises working ranch horses and cutting horses. Mendota Ranch also serves as a location for Sniper training for multiple defense organizations. The Mendota Ranch offers a:
